2. Understanding Impact Resistance in Plastics
Impact resistance refers to the ability of a material to withstand sudden forces or shocks without fracturing. This property is crucial in many applications, including automotive, construction, and consumer goods. Plastics are often chosen for their light weight and versatility; however, they can be prone to cracking or breaking under stress.
**Impact resistance in plastics** is influenced by several factors, including molecular structure, material composition, and the presence of additives. As industries evolve, the demand for tougher plastics continues to grow, leading to the innovative use of PC toughening agents.

4. Mechanisms of PC Toughening Agents
Understanding the **mechanisms of PC toughening agents** is essential for appreciating their role in plastics. These agents typically incorporate a combination of physical and chemical processes to enhance impact resistance:
4.1 Energy Absorption
When a plastic material undergoes impact, it experiences stress that can lead to failure. PC toughening agents help absorb and redistribute this energy across the material, reducing the likelihood of crack propagation.
4.2 Phase Separation
In many cases, the incorporation of PC toughening agents leads to phase separation within the polymer matrix. This phenomenon creates microscopic domains that enhance the toughness of the material by providing additional barriers to crack growth.
4.3 Morphology Modification
The addition of PC toughening agents can change the morphology of the plastic. This alteration can result in a more ductile material that can better withstand deformation under stress, thereby improving overall impact strength.
5. Applications of PC Toughening Agents in Various Industries
PC toughening agents find applications across a multitude of industries due to their effectiveness in enhancing impact resistance:
5.1 Automotive Industry
In the automotive sector, lightweight materials are essential for fuel efficiency. PC toughening agents are used in components such as bumpers and light housings. Their ability to withstand impact without shattering is crucial for safety.
5.2 Electronics
For electronic devices, durability is vital. PC toughening agents improve the impact resistance of casings and screens, ensuring that devices can survive drops and bumps.
5.4 Construction Materials
In construction, materials that can endure harsh weather and physical stress are necessary. PC toughening agents enhance the performance of plastics used in windows, doors, and roofing materials.
